With the season now just a fortnight away, we turn our attentions to a number of kindly priced midfielders in our latest article for members. Picking the right combinations in the mid-price bracket looks crucial to a strong start and with Fantasy managers debating the merits of a number of targets, we scour the statistics to assess their previous form.

For the purpose of this article, we’ve selected seven midfielders, no more than 6.5 in the Fantasy Premier League (FPL) game, who have proven popular picks so far and/or are set for some favourable opening fixtures – potentially affording them the chance to hand us an early-season bandwagon. Comparing their respective statistics, we also dig deeper into seasons gone by in our attempt to ascertain the best options for our initial lineups.
